Crema's Take
“Tucked into Portland's vibrant Mississippi Street neighborhood, this quirky spot channels a Beatles-inspired aesthetic while serving up inventive breakfast dishes that steal the show—the Yolko Ono is a cult favorite for good reason, with perfectly balanced sausage, pillowy eggs, and a zippy pesto that keeps people coming back. The space feels refreshingly unpretentious with excellent natural light, killer playlist energy, and both cozy indoor nooks and breezy outdoor seating that make it equally perfect for a solo coffee ritual or catching up with friends over really good food.”
